Transaction 97488bf714bd3273e4e91d04afb7091108a18e57fc76d242334556e8c7935574
1 Input
2 Outputs
- 97488bf714bd3273e4e91d04afb7091108a18e57fc76d242334556e8c7935574:0
- 97488bf714bd3273e4e91d04afb7091108a18e57fc76d242334556e8c7935574:1
value 401078160
address 1KMUkEA84nQuUC7RiJdhZnZtiKqjyxwYW6
value 8742329767
address 1BNQGnccHYgexkrwd2rtwriExRZx2APuB2